Output e33bc4124f774d6cdb231bde1f29b03c44395a061762fbf658a5cbaa409a06de:5

value
503700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f854fb10e1221e8bd5752bf7cb982bf68a460fdc OP_EQUALVERIFY OP_CHECKSIG
address
1Pe4P92KHgeiH4WLKUzjeTrq1cmUBZEzva
transaction
e33bc4124f774d6cdb231bde1f29b03c44395a061762fbf658a5cbaa409a06de
spent
true